I have connected a tape (Scsi HP Ultrium 460) on a Solaris
system and put it on , prtconf shows the line "tape (driver not attached)". How can I install/configure the tape to use it. Thanks for help.
Djessi
 
Hi Djessi, see if the system configures it when you run devfsadm -c tape (man devfsadm for details). It should add an entry in /dev/rmt if successful.

If what Ken suggested doesn't work then go to the ok prompt and do a probe-scsi-all to see if the drive is seen at the hardware level.

THIS TAPE UNIT NEEDS TO BE DEFINED IN /KERNEL/DRV/ST.CONF
IF THERE IS NO ENTRY FOR THE ULTRIUM 460 THE OS WILL NOT LOAD DRIVERS OR RECOGNIZE THE TAPE UNIT. YOU MAY NEED TO LOOK AROUND THE WEB TO FIND CORRECT ENTRIES FOR THE TAPE UNIT.
